
Whitehaven have signed centre Chris Taylor for the third time, welcoming back a hugely popular player for the club.
Having initially signed ahead of the 2014 campaign Taylor played 182 times for Haven across two spells and in that time scored 50 tries and landed one drop goal to bring up a total of 201 points.
The experienced centre was with Haven for a short spell first time before a move to Halifax ahead of the 2015 season.
He returned mid-way through that campaign and remained with the club until the end of the 2023 campaign.
Taylor made the move to Workington to link up with Anthony Murray last season but has returned to The Ortus Rec ahead of the 2025 League 1 campaign.
Head coach Anthony Murray said: “Chris will be a great signing for us, especially having a long connection with the club after playing 10 seasons. I have always been an admirer of Chris and even more so now having worked with him at Town last year.
“Chris will bring a wealth of experience but also his professional attitude and work ethics will help our young squad and I’m sure he will have a great season.”
